Nick Lowe Trivia Questions

How much do you really know about Nick Lowe? Below are 8 true or false statements. Click each one to reveal the answer and explanation.

1.

Nick Lowe is often called 'The Godfather of Power Pop' due to his melodic rock style.

Click to reveal answer ›

Easy
✓ TRUE

While not as widely known as the 'Godfather of Punk', Lowe earned this nickname for his punchy, catchy, guitar-driven pop songs.

2.

Nick Lowe famously recorded a song titled 'Cruel to Be Kind' in the late 1970s.

Click to reveal answer ›

Easy
✓ TRUE

Released in 1979, 'Cruel to Be Kind' became Lowe's biggest solo hit, reaching the Top 40 in both the US and UK.

3.

Nick Lowe once wrote a hit song for Elvis Costello called 'Pump It Up'.

Click to reveal answer ›

Medium
✗ FALSE

Lowe produced Costello's albums and wrote '(What's So Funny 'Bout) Peace, Love and Understanding', but 'Pump It Up' was written by Costello.

4.

Nick Lowe was a member of the pub rock band Brinsley Schwarz before going solo.

Click to reveal answer ›

Medium
✓ TRUE

Lowe played bass and sang in Brinsley Schwarz, a key British pub rock band that helped shape the late 1970s music scene.

5.

Nick Lowe wrote the classic Christmas song 'Merry Christmas Everybody' for Slade.

Click to reveal answer ›

Medium
✗ FALSE

That festive anthem was written by Noddy Holder and Jim Lea of Slade. Lowe's own Christmas classic is 'Christmas at the Airport'.

6.

Nick Lowe is the father-in-law of legendary musician Johnny Cash.

Click to reveal answer ›

Hard
✗ FALSE

Lowe is actually the father-in-law of Johnny Cash's son, John Carter Cash, not of Johnny Cash himself.

7.

Nick Lowe's song 'What's So Funny 'Bout Peace, Love and Understanding' was first released by his band Brinsley Schwarz.

Click to reveal answer ›

Hard
✓ TRUE

Lowe wrote it for Brinsley Schwarz in 1974, though it became far more famous when Elvis Costello covered it in 1979.

8.

Nick Lowe produced the debut album for the British punk band The Damned.

Click to reveal answer ›

Hard
✓ TRUE

Lowe produced The Damned's 1977 debut 'Damned Damned Damned', a landmark punk album, showing his versatility as a producer.
